What Are Senior Medical Devices
Senior medical devices encompass a wide range of health monitoring and emergency response technologies designed specifically for older adults. These devices include medical alert systems, glucose monitors for diabetes management, hearing aids, and wearable health trackers.
The primary purpose of these devices is to help seniors maintain their independence while providing safety nets for emergencies. Diabetes devices monitor blood sugar levels, while medical alert systems provide instant access to emergency services. Each device serves a specific health need common among aging populations.
How Senior Medical Devices Work
Most senior medical devices operate through simple interfaces designed for ease of use. Medical alert systems for seniors typically feature large buttons that connect directly to monitoring centers when pressed. These systems work through cellular networks or landline connections to ensure reliable communication.
Health monitoring devices collect data automatically and transmit information to healthcare providers or family members. Hearing devices for elderly amplify sounds while filtering background noise. Modern devices often include smartphone connectivity, allowing remote monitoring and data sharing with medical professionals.
Device Comparison Analysis
The market offers various options for senior medical devices, each with distinct features and capabilities. Best medical alert systems for seniors vary in terms of range, battery life, and monitoring services. Life Alert provides 24/7 monitoring with waterproof devices, while Medical Guardian offers GPS-enabled mobile units.
For diabetes management, devices range from basic glucose meters to continuous monitoring systems. Dexcom provides real-time glucose tracking, while traditional meters require manual testing. Hearing aids for seniors include options from Phonak and ReSound, offering different levels of amplification and connectivity features.
Benefits and Considerations
Elderly monitoring systems provide numerous advantages including immediate emergency response, health data tracking, and family peace of mind. These devices can detect falls, monitor vital signs, and provide medication reminders. The technology helps seniors remain in their homes longer while maintaining safety.
However, some considerations include device complexity, monthly service fees, and potential false alarms. Best medical alert bracelet for seniors options require regular charging and proper maintenance. Users must also consider comfort, waterproof features, and range limitations when selecting devices.
Pricing and Coverage Options
Costs for senior medical devices vary significantly based on features and service levels. Basic medical alert systems start around thirty dollars monthly, while advanced GPS-enabled units cost more. Senior medical alert systems covered by Medicare may include certain qualifying devices under specific circumstances.
Insurance coverage depends on medical necessity and device type. Some health monitoring devices for elderly qualify for Medicare reimbursement when prescribed by physicians. Private insurance plans may cover portions of costs, particularly for diabetes management devices and hearing aids. Veterans may access devices through VA benefits programs.
